Installation Guide
Tools Needed:
- Adjustable wrench
- Level
- Screwdrivers (flat and Phillips)
- Pliers
- Tape measure
- Pipe thread seal tape
Step-by-Step Installation
- Choose Installation Location: Select a location near water supply, drain, and electrical connections on a solid, level floor under countertop.
- Remove Shipping Materials: Remove all shipping bolts, brackets and packaging materials from the dishwasher interior.
- Connect Water Supply: Connect hot water supply line to the water inlet valve. Use only new hoses and apply thread seal tape.
- Connect Drain Hose: Route the drain hose into sink drain or garbage disposal with a high loop to prevent backflow.
- Electrical Connection: Connect to a properly grounded 120V, 60Hz, AC only outlet. Hardwired models require professional installation.
- Level the Dishwasher: Adjust the leveling legs to ensure the dishwasher is level from front to back and side to side.
- Test Run: Run the dishwasher through a complete cycle to check for leaks and proper operation.

Troubleshooting
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
---|---|---|
Dishwasher won't start | Power issue, door not closed properly, child lock engaged | Check power supply, ensure door is latched completely, check child lock |
Poor cleaning results | Overloading, wrong detergent, clogged spray arms, low water temperature | Rearrange load, use correct detergent, clean spray arms, check water heater |
Water not draining | Drain hose clogged or kinked, drain pump blocked | Check drain hose for obstructions or kinks, clean drain pump filter |
Leaking water | Door not sealed, overfilling, loose connections, worn door gasket | Check door seal, ensure proper detergent amount, check connections, replace gasket |
Unusual noises | Foreign objects in pump, spray arm hitting dishes, worn wash motor | Check for foreign objects, rearrange load, contact service if motor noise |
Dishes not drying | Rinse aid empty, heated dry option off, overloading | Refill rinse aid, enable heated dry, reduce load size for better air circulation |
